Define Functions of Manganese?
Like other micro minerals, Mn also functions in mammalian enzyme systems. It can function both as an integral part of metalloenzymes and as an enzyme activator. Manganese containing metalloenzymes are few, as shown in Table, whereas enzymes activated by Mn are much larger in number. Most of these metal activations by Mn are non-specific, as magnesium (Mg) can substitute for Mn. There are a few exceptions where Mn be specifically needed for activation. Examples include, activation of glycosyl transferases, phosphoenol/phruvate carboxykinase and glutarnine synthetase.
Glutamine synthetase found in high concentration in the brain catalyzes the following reaction:
NH3 + Glutamate + ATP + Glutamine + ADP + Pi
Thus, glutamate synthetase converts potentially toxic ammonia into glutamine and helps in the removal of ammonia (NH3) as it is generated. It is interesting to note that even in severe Mn deficiency in animals, brain glutamine synthetase activity is maintained normal, suggesting that this enzyme has a high priority among the enzymes activated by Mn or that Mg can replace Mn.
